WebLong-term care accommodation costs. All long-term care home residents are required to contribute towards the cost of accommodation and meals. This is called a co-payment fee. The amount of your co-payment fee is based on whether you are in a basic, semi-private or private room. Regardless of room type, all long-term care residents are entitled ...
